English
Etymology
hyper- + sensitive. Doublet of supersensitive.
Adjective
hypersensitive (comparative more hypersensitive, superlative most hypersensitive)
- Highly or abnormally sensitive to some substances or agents, especially to some allergen.
- Excessively sensitive; easily offended.
